Output 8c95c6141d38b3e77a2fdda21f4f8a662821d8f29e31e3638218cb5253a5b515:1

value
178578142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 372e6f8b41de92ea223802d5ffea47b5b928b9c6 OP_EQUALVERIFY OP_CHECKSIG
address
162mnxjhHtM4GDhhjv5p9FiNQsuHPRpAeP
transaction
8c95c6141d38b3e77a2fdda21f4f8a662821d8f29e31e3638218cb5253a5b515
spent
true